36 of 39 people found the following review helpful:
1.0 out of 5 stars Less filling, April 29, 2002
By A Customer
What HP doesn't tell you about this ink cartridge is that it costs almost the same as their venerable 45 cartridge, but that one holds 41ml of ink, while this one only holds 25ml. So you would appear to get 1/3 less printing (and pages) per cartridge (for roughly the same price) with a printer that uses this cartridge, as opposed to if you bought a printer that used the 45 (you have no choice if you have a printer than needs the 15 cartridge, you've got to buy it to keep using the printer). I guess they have to make their money somehow!

5.0 out of 5 stars How to make you ink last longer (more pages to print), September 23, 2009
Hi,

In your printer profile, select preferences, then
select draft mode, this saves a lot of ink.
next click Black & White (instead of Color),
this saves you more money.

rename the printer by adding B&W to the name,
ie HP 890C B&W. Use this as your default printer.

add a second printer using the same model you have now.
You now have two logical printers but only one physical printer.
Rename it HP 890 Color for example.

When you need color for the kids reports or greeting cards,
send the print to the color printer, otherwise send to B&W printer.

You can do this with any printer, even at your office to
save on toner if it is a laser.

1.0 out of 5 stars Peeved, September 6, 2002
By A Customer
HP lured me in. Consumer Reports rated the HP 712C printer extremely well. I jumped all over the HP 812C W/USB port because it's the same as the 712C except it has the USB port right? Wrong! HP designed the 812C with the 25ml black cartridge instead of the 45 ml that the 712C printer uses. This printer has cost me a fortune in cartridges. I'll think long and hard before buying another HP printer.
